Students in the LEAP program at TJL utilized the “SuperPowered” FIRST Lego League curriculum to learn about robotics and renewable energy. Through the building of mission models, students were introduced to some of the energy challenges the world is currently facing. They worked in small groups to design and code robots to complete the missions. They also chose an energy problem to research in depth and create an innovative solution to deal with that problem. The students created displays and models to share their research and solutions. Parents were invited to a robotics festival on April 25 to view and celebrate all of their hard work.
